What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a short term disability analyst,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Short Term Disability Analyst, you need a solid understanding of insurance policies, claims management, and medical terminology, usually supported by a degree in a related field and experience in disability claims. Familiarity with claims processing software, case management systems, and regulatory compliance tools is typically expected. Strong analytical thinking, attention to detail, and clear communication help analysts assess claims accurately and interact effectively with claimants and healthcare providers. These skills ensure timely, fair adjudication of claims while maintaining legal compliance and customer satisfaction.

What is a short term disability analyst?

A Short Term Disability Analyst is a professional who evaluates and processes claims for short term disability benefits. They review medical documents, verify eligibility, and determine the appropriate benefits for employees who are temporarily unable to work due to illness or injury. Their responsibilities often include communicating with claimants, employers, and medical providers to gather necessary information and ensure claims comply with company policies and regulations. The goal is to provide timely and accurate support to individuals during their period of disability.

What are some common challenges faced by short term disability analysts, and how can they be effectively managed?

Short Term Disability Analysts often encounter challenges such as interpreting complex medical documentation, balancing a high caseload, and ensuring timely communication with claimants, healthcare providers, and employers. Staying organized and up-to-date with regulatory changes is essential for managing these tasks efficiently. Developing strong communication skills, leveraging claims management software, and participating in ongoing training can help analysts navigate these challenges while ensuring accurate and fair claim assessments.
